A leading media agency is seeking a Media Planning Manager to lead client interactions and develop tailored media strategies for campaigns. This role involves understanding client needs, managing budgets, and delivering impactful media solutions while collaborating with cross‑functional teams to achieve objectives.
Candidates should have solid planning knowledge, excellent communication skills, and experience with multiple stakeholders. This is a 4-month contract role based in London, England.

How to prepare for a job interview at Mediahub Worldwide
✨Know Your Media Planning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on your media planning knowledge before the interview. Understand the latest trends, tools, and strategies in the industry. Be ready to discuss how you've successfully developed tailored media strategies in the past.
✨Showcase Your Communication Skills
Since this role involves client interactions, practice articulating your thoughts clearly and confidently. Prepare examples of how you've effectively communicated with clients and stakeholders to achieve campaign objectives.
✨Budget Management is Key
Be prepared to discuss your experience with managing budgets. Think of specific instances where you’ve optimised spending or delivered impactful results within budget constraints. This will show your potential employer that you can handle financial aspects of media planning.
✨Collaboration is Crucial
This role requires working with cross-functional teams, so highlight your teamwork skills. Prepare anecdotes that demonstrate how you've collaborated with different departments to deliver successful campaigns. This will illustrate your ability to work well in a team environment.
